cvc-complex-type.2.4.c issues - a few things to check

I've battled with the Spring cvc-complex-type.2.4.c issue on a few occasions but with them far enough apart that I can't remember what the steps are to solve it. This time round I thought I would write it down... You are writing a Spring-based app and you have some of your bean declarations in XML (I also use annotations but that's not important here). You wire your beans, you write your code and you build your application. Everything compiles and builds correctly, you run up your app in your container (in my case the dreaded Glassfish) and BOOM: Caused by: org.xml.sax.SAXParseException; lineNumber: 30; columnNumber: 76; cvc-complex-type.2.4.c: The matching wildcard is strict, but no declaration can be found for element 'jms:listener-container'. at com.sun.org.apache.xerces.internal.util.ErrorHandlerWrapper. createSAXParseException(ErrorHandlerWrapper.java:198) Here are a few things to check: Check that you have a element in your XM
